Transaction 523ef64d2b3d69aab416993dbe0b235731a86ad2aff8b1e103ca78cf865fc28b

1 Input
2 Outputs
  • 523ef64d2b3d69aab416993dbe0b235731a86ad2aff8b1e103ca78cf865fc28b:0
  • value  200000000
    address  1QDNr344zNZyzD2fh3hDmzTU616DWkrfzT
  • 523ef64d2b3d69aab416993dbe0b235731a86ad2aff8b1e103ca78cf865fc28b:1
  • value  128434557
    address  3QGCvErcbdr66PuLnMTN78pFzXRqe6RsQm